AIRPORT GOMMISS ION <br />CITY OF RAMSEY <br />ANOKA COUNTY <br />STATE OF MINNESO~ <br /> <br />~he Airport Co~mission conducted a regular meeting on Wednesday, November 20, <br />1985 at the R~msey Municipal Center, 15153 Nowthen Blvd. N.W., Ramsey, <br />Minnesota. <br /> <br />Members Present: <br /> <br />Mr. Jack Ippel, Chairman <br />Mr. Dennis Donovan <br />Mr. Dick Sieber <br />Mr. John Seibert <br />Mr. Don Greenberg (Arrived 8:05 a.m.) <br /> <br />Also Present: <br /> <br />Mayor Gary Heitman <br /> <br />Chairman Ippel called the meeting to order at 7:40 p.m. <br /> <br />Gary Munkholm - 14940 Bison Street - Concerned with increased air traffic and <br />the relate(] no~se if the airport project is approved; already being disturbed <br />by low flyingi aircraft and those types of situations are bound to increase with <br />increased useage. Concerned with the cost to taxpayers for airport <br />enlargement. Suggested that there might be a more cost effective location than <br />Gateway that WOuld not require the purchasing of so much already developed <br />properties. <br /> <br />Mr. Ippel encouraged Mr. Munkholm to report low flying aircraft to Virgil <br />Barnes at~ateway. Regarding an alternative location, this Commission was <br />directed tO study the feasibility of the existing site; that study shows that <br />the cost of i~proving Gateway, based on current population and no community <br />growth, would be $11.00/person/year. <br /> <br />Mr. Sieberconfirmed that this Commission was to study the existing site only; <br />Gateway, tO so~e degreee, is a reasonable site because it already is an airport <br />and alread~ has some buffer area surrounding it. Gateway might be conceivably <br />easier to ~oliCe if it were a full-time Fixed Base Operation. <br /> <br />Mr. Ippel Stated that a good n~ber of low flying aircraft might be training <br />flights that USe this site because of it's low useage rate; if the airport is <br />improved there will be more business traffic and training traffic will move <br />elsewhere. <br /> <br />Mr. Seibert estimated that 50% of the existing estimated operations in the <br />Airport MaSter Plan are touch and go training operations; when and if the <br />airport is .improved, those kinds of operations will decrease.
